Commercial Concrete Painting in Boulder, CO
Commercial concrete painting services involve applying durable, high-quality coatings to concrete surfaces to enhance appearance and protect the underlying material. These services are commonly requested for projects such as parking lots, driveways, sidewalks, loading docks, and warehouse floors. Property owners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create designated parking areas, or increase the longevity of concrete surfaces by providing a protective barrier against weather, stains, and wear.
Before requesting commercial concrete painting, property owners typically want to understand the condition of the existing concrete, including any cracks, spalling, or surface damage that may need repair prior to painting. They also consider the type of coating suitable for their specific project, whether for aesthetic purposes or added durability. Clarifying the desired finish, color options, and any specific requirements for slip resistance or environmental factors can help ensure the project meets expectations and provides long-lasting results.

Commercial Concrete Painting Questions
What types of concrete surfaces can be painted? Commercial concrete painting can be applied to driveways, parking lots, warehouse floors, and other large concrete areas on commercial properties.
Is concrete painting suitable for outdoor or indoor projects? It is suitable for both outdoor surfaces like parking areas and indoor floors such as warehouses and retail spaces.
What benefits does concrete painting provide? It enhances the appearance, improves durability, and can help define different areas within commercial spaces.
How should surfaces be prepared before painting? Surfaces should be clean, free of debris, and properly repaired to ensure proper adhesion of the paint.
